Job Overview

A law firm seeks an experienced patent attorney in Phoenix with a background in electrical engineering for full-time employment. The ideal candidate will have a strong academic record and extensive experience in patent application preparation and prosecution related to electrical engineering, computer engineering, software, and semiconductor manufacturing processes.

Duties

  • Prepare and prosecute patent applications in electrical engineering and related fields.
  • Engage in patent litigation and provide litigation support.
  • Conduct inter partes reviews (IPR) as needed.
  • Collaborate with clients to understand their patent needs and strategies.

Requirements

  • Minimum of five years of full-time experience in patent law.
  • Experience with semiconductor packaging and processing technologies.
  • Prior in-house counsel or litigation experience preferred.
  • Ability to bring a modest book of business is desirable.

Education

  • Juris Doctor (JD) degree from an accredited law school.

Certifications

  • Admission to the state bar.
  • Registered to practice before the U.S. Patent and Trademark Office.
